Manhattan Bridge: Construction
Connecting two metropolitan areas (Brooklyn and Manhattan), a suspension bridge crosses the East River Strait.
The main reason for the construction of the legendary structure was the huge load on the Brooklyn Bridge. Constant traffic jams interfered with normal traffic, and the city had an urgent need to build a suspension structure, which began in March 1909. And on December 31, the Manhattan bridge, 2089 meters long, was commissioned.

Tiers of construction
Having two levels, Manhattan Bridge has long been a favorite place for walks in the heart of America. On the upper tier there are four lanes for moving cars.
The lower one is used for freight transport, in addition, there are laid railway lines for the city metro, daily transporting a huge number of people. On the bridge there are pedestrian and bicycle paths fenced with a grid.

Baroque arch
One cannot fail to tell about the main difference between a unique work of architecture and its neighbors - an impressive arch with colonnades at the entrance, made in the Baroque style. A kind of gate to the Manhattan Bridge was created a few years after its opening. The famous sculptor Heber was engaged in the development of panels with two figures embodying the spirit of trade and industry.
At the top of the recently reconstructed arch is a composition depicting an Indian hunt for a bison, made by an American author. And on the back there were stone statues of two women, symbolizing Manhattan and Brooklyn, which connects the bridge. After several decades, the statues were transferred to the museum to expand the space.
Such luxuriously designed portals make Manhattan Bridge one of the most aesthetically attractive transport structures. Interestingly, the area in front of the arch completely repeats the outlines of the Roman square of St. Peter.
Repair work
During the passage of trains, fluctuations were observed, becoming more noticeable every day. The country's transport department acknowledged the problem, after which a decision was made on large-scale repairs that began in 1984 and lasted more than ten years.
Subway traffic on the lower tier was limited. Four lanes of railways were gradually closed for restoration work, and the number of trains passing was significantly reduced. Only in 2004, all four metro lines were re-engaged.
Disturbing video
And recently, an amateur video shot by a local artist for a creative project has become the reason for discussion among Americans. Everyone saw how the Manhattan Bridge, which immediately got to the first pages of the media, vibrates violently from cars and trains passing by it.
Concerned residents cut off the Department of Transportation's telephone to find out the current state of affairs. The government department issued an official statement saying that such a wiggle, not exceeding forty centimeters, is provided for by the suspension structure of the bridge itself. For more than a hundred years, the construction has been raised and lowered thanks to special flexible cables, and after the repair work has been carried out aimed at enhancing the safety of passengers, the citizens of the country have nothing to fear.
Popular bridge
More than 75 thousand cars, 320 thousand metro passengers and about three thousand pedestrians and cyclists cross the Manhattan Bridge in New York every day.
The famous hanging structure has been used repeatedly as decorations in popular Hollywood films such as King Kong, Once Upon a Time in America, Independence Day, I Am a Legend, Panic in New York.
